    Abstract: Discussed are an FFS mode LCD device capable of enhancing a transmittance ratio by including a color filter of a three-dimensional pattern structure having a transmissive pattern for selectively transmitting light of a specific wavelength by using a surface plasmon phenomenon, and a method for fabricating the same. The metal layer using a surface plasmon is utilized as a common electrode of the array substrate, and the pixel electrode having slits is formed on the metal film, thereby generating a fringe field. This may simplify the entire processes, and remove color filter processing lines, thereby reducing the installation costs.

    Abstract: The present invention provides a device for conducting dynamic analysis of embedded software of a vehicle. More particularly, it relates to a device for dynamically analyzing embedded software of the vehicle to detect real time errors of embedded software based on the analysis. More specifically, a data communication unit communicates data in real time with an electronic unit of the vehicle; and a control unit that monitors the condition of one or more hardware components which are used by embedded software of an electric field based on the data received through the data communication unit, and thereby outputs the monitored result accordingly.

    Abstract: The present invention relates to a reservoir tank for an automobile, which is provided with a height-adjustable sub filler neck so as to be retracted when not in use and extracted when filling coolant, whereby the reservoir tank can be disposed low in the automobile. The reservoir tank forming a cooling module together with a condenser, a radiator and a fan and shroud assembly is disposed at a carrier, and includes a filler neck for filling coolant and a cap for closing the filler neck, and is communicated with a radiator so as to control an amount of the coolant in the radiator, wherein the reservoir tank is integrally formed with a shroud of the fan and the shroud assembly, and the filler neck is formed with a sub filler neck which is retracted into and extracted from the filler neck.

    Abstract: Blades mounted on a circumferential outer surface of a hub of an axial flow fan do not deform even when rotated at high speed, thus promoting structural stability. The direction of the sweeping angle of each blade alternately changes between the blade root and tip. A chord length between the blade leading and trailing edges gradually decreases from the blade root to an intermediate portion of the blade, and the chord length gradually increases from a predetermined position on the intermediate portion of the blade to the blade tip.

    Abstract: A fan and shroud assembly has a rotatable hub and plural blades extending outward from the hub. A shroud surrounding the fan controls air blast resulting from rotation of the fan. The shroud includes a guide ring spaced a predetermined distance from the periphery of the fan. The ends of the blades are connected together. The guide ring includes continuous circular undulations having alternate differing radii of curvature to reduce air swirl along the periphery of the fan. The undulations surround the fan periphery.

    Abstract: In a method of manufacturing a capacitor and a method of manufacturing a dynamic random access memory device, an insulating layer covering an upper portion of a conductive layer may be provided with an ozone gas so as to change the property of the upper portion of the insulating layer. The upper portion of the insulating layer may be chemically removed to expose the upper portion of the conductive layer. The exposed upper portion of the conductive layer may be removed so as to transform the conductive layer into a lower electrode. The remaining portion of the insulating layer may be removed, and an upper electrode may be formed on the lower electrode.
